| spo·ro·cyst [ spáwrō sìst ] (plural spo·ro·cysts)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
1. case protecting sporozoites: a protective case produced by sporozoans in which sporozoites develop
|
2. encased sporozoite: a sporozoite protected within a case
|
3. structure producing spores: a structure that produces spores, formed by a parasite within its host
